How to apply

To apply, submit a written application, including:

  • an up-to-date CV;
  • address the essential and desired assessment criteria (see position description);
  • describe your experience, knowledge and skills relevant to the duties (see position description).

Applications are to be submitted via the prompts to Peter McGlone, CEO, Tasmanian Conservation Trust, via the prompts.

All applicants must be available for an in-person interview.

Job Description

The Tasmanian Conservation Trust is looking for a part-time ‘Climate Campaigner’ to work in its Hobart office. The position is 3.0 days per week. Annual salary is $51,063 plus on-costs.
